Job Summary

Langan is seeking a Senior Geotechnical Project Engineer to join its collaborative team in New York. This individual will serve a key function in managing client interaction, providing staff training and project leadership, performing numerical analyses to simulate foundation settlements, site‑specific seismic studies, preparation of technical reports, specifications, plans, designing foundations, and other geotechnical aspects of construction. In this role, you will partner cross‑functionally with top industry leadership in an ever‑evolving environment.

Job Responsibilities
  • Perform or check numerical analyses to model building foundations, excavations, and dewatering
  • Perform or check site‑specific seismic studies (developing ground motions, ground response analyses, develop code‑compliant recommendations);
  • Preparation of technical reports, specifications, and geotechnical recommendations;
  • Preparation of proposals, coordinating projects, managing clients and managing billings;
  • Provide mentorship, coaching, and review of work for staff;
  • Perform observation during construction projects;
  • Perform and manage multiple projects and tasks within specific budgets, schedules, and deadlines. Monitor budgets, schedules, and project timelines;
  • Perform other duties as requested.
Qualifications
  • Master's degree in Geotechnical Engineering with a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ering or related field; PhD preferred;
  • Professional Engineer licensure;
  • 10+ years related geotechnical experience;
  • Prior experience with geotechnical investigations and construction inspections;
  • Office experience with investigation and field work coordination, geotechnical reports, and specification writing;
  • Prior field experience in: earthwork, driven and drilled pile construction, load testing, footings subgrade and backfill inspection, ground improvements, retaining wall design and construction, and excavation support system design and inspection;
  • Desired software knowledge: PLAXIS, DEEPEX, FLAC2D/3D, LS-DYNA, LPILE, CLIQ, DEEPSOIL/RSSEISMIC, OPENQUAKE;
  • Desired knowledge of ASCE 7;
  • Required working knowledge of EXCEL, WORD, POWERPOINT;
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ills;
  • Strong attention to detail with excellent analytical, multitasking, and judgment capabilities;
  • Ability to effectively work independently and in a team environment;
  • Some field work is required;
  • Possess reliable transportation for client meetings and job site visits and a valid driver’s license in good standing.
